QUOTE(munchoong @ Dec 26 2019, 04:19 PM)
Just take care TO AVOID Captain America: Civil War.

The Asian release of Civil War has lossy DTS-HD HR 7.1 audio, instead of the lossless DTS-HD MA 7.1 audio.

AFAIK all other MCU BDs do not have this weird problem.

QUOTE(Andrewtst @ Mar 30 2020, 10:21 PM)
I check the box before, and as usual only 4K UHD Blu-ray is region free. Blu-ray wise is region A and DVD is region 3.
*
finally the BDA made a wise decision to drop the region-coding nonsense on its 4K UHD home media...

how sad to remember back then when dvd started the whole region-coding mess – i bought my then RM2.5k pioneer dvd player that couldn't play my RM135 US-imported R1 Terminator 2 Judgment Day dvd some 23 years ago!! just when i was excited like crazy jumping onto the so-called advanced new digital home media format and suddenly left me sleepless nights for days caused by this problem doh.gif laugh.gif
